The length-weight relationship between fish and their bodies is a crucial tool for describing key biological aspects of fish stock. This includes: measuring lengths of the species to determine the fish\'s weight, as well as estimating its growth rate using the allometric coefficient. Also, analyzing the body condition of the specimens of fish. The knowledge and data gained from the study of the functional relationship between length and weight of fish are crucial for providing fish stock assessments and for developing fish stock condition analyses and strict fisheries monitoring programs.

The present research examines the length-weight relationship using a MATLAB-based software. This allows for the application of linear regression analysis to data sets of length and weight measurements from sprats and anchovy commercial catch sample. The second stage validates the nonlinear length and weight relationship model W(i). Under certain conditions, both linear and nonlinear models can be valid and statistically significant in the present analysis. These are the relevant conclusions and analyses, as well as a comparison of the accuracy and analysis of results obtained using the models discussed above.
